Two Tone Wedding Bands

November 15th, 2009

If your looking for wedding bands consider from the large assortment of two tone wedding bands. They are stylish and attractive and will always be fashionable. One of the may reasons as why they are popular is that people like the fact that this style of ring with can go with most other jewelry such as watches or bracelets.
Two tone wedding rings are produced with two different colors and often with different metals such as white and yellow gold, platinum, titanium, and sterling silver to name a few. Depending on your budget, the lower price ring would have 10K yellow gold and sterling silver, while for a more expensive and stunning ring it could have 18K yellow gold and platinum. Two tone wedding bands are often custom made and can be made with embellishments that will make your ring unique.

Tips For A Great Best Mans Speech

November 2nd, 2009

When you’ve got to do a best mans speech the key thing is preparation and knowing the etiquette of proceedings. Look at some best man speech examples and focus on making notes, creating an outline and timing your speech so it isn’t a long drawn out affair. Add a dash of humor but make sure you don’t cross the line and try to leave the bride out of the equation unless you know her very well. Your best friend and groom will forgive you for a corny joke. Also don’t drink too much before you deliver the speech. A small amount may give you dutch courage, but too much could mean you end up forgetting your lines and you definitely don’t want that.
